How the AI Translates Words into Math
The AI solver uses natural language processing to parse word problems. It identifies key phrases that signal mathematical operations: "more than" suggests addition, "less than" suggests subtraction, "of" often means multiplication, "per" indicates division or rate. It also identifies the unknown quantities and assigns variables to them.
After parsing, the AI constructs one or more equations that represent the relationships described in the problem. It then solves the equations using appropriate algebraic or arithmetic methods, and finally translates the mathematical answer back into a sentence that answers the original question.
Common Word Problem Categories
Rate, Time, and Distance Problems
Problems involving speed, travel time, and distance use the fundamental relationship d = rt. The AI handles single-traveler problems, two-traveler problems (meeting or catching up), round-trip problems, and current or wind problems that add or subtract from the base rate. Each problem is organized with a clear table showing rate, time, and distance for each component.
Mixture and Solution Problems
Mixing two solutions of different concentrations, combining products at different prices, or blending ingredients in specific ratios all follow the same algebraic structure. The solver sets up the mixture equation, showing how the amount of pure substance in each component combines to form the final mixture.
Work Rate Problems
When two or more workers or machines complete a job at different individual rates, the AI calculates the combined rate and determines how long the job takes when they work together. It handles problems where workers start at different times, take breaks, or work at varying efficiencies.
Age Problems
Age problems that compare ages at different points in time are translated into algebraic equations. The AI identifies the reference point (present, past, or future), defines variables for unknown ages, and sets up equations based on the stated relationships.
Percent and Interest Problems
Simple and compound interest calculations, percent increase and decrease, markup and discount problems, and tax calculations are solved with clear formula application. The AI distinguishes between simple interest (I = Prt) and compound interest (A = P(1 + r/n)^(nt)) and applies the correct formula.
